Skip to content

Conversation

@tsalo
Copy link
Member

@tsalo tsalo commented Oct 14, 2017

  • Add posters and presentations on OSF.
  • Include date in asset filenames.
  • Show posters on team member page if author of any kind (not just
    first author)
    • First-author filtering is still applied to presentations. I
      figure that, since it’s (generally) one person actually talking, that seems fair.
      Can be changed later if necessary.
  • Use resampled images for thumbnails on site. This will make the site
    load faster and will reduce the amount of space we take up.
  • Rename lab member pages by last name first to improve sorting.
  • I’m really proud of this one --> Split the posters, presentations, etc.
    by year in the overview pages.
    • This one took some Liquid-fu. Just saying.
  • Enforce constant widths in tables so that separate tables line up.
  • Fix minor typo in Ranjita’s news update.
  • Stop listing news post author on homepage.
  • I’ve done a pretty solid job of dealing with the photo aspect ratios.
  • Add borders around most images. Especially helpful for papers/presentations with white backgrounds.
  • Check out those social icons on the Team page!!!!
    • Also, it's a Wes Anderson palette, in case anyone was wondering.
  • Add some more papers and projects.
  • Make Projects page a table like the other pages.
  • Hopefully improve search engine discoverability.

benshe3 and others added 4 commits October 10, 2017 12:07
- Add posters and presentations on OSF.
- Include date in asset filenames.
- Show posters on team member page if author of any kind (not just
first author)
    - First-author filtering is still applied to presentations. I
figure that, since it’s one person actually talking, that seems fair.
Can be changed later if necessary.
- Use resampled images for thumbnails on site. This will make the site
load faster and will reduce the amount of space we take up.
- Rename lab member pages by last name first to improve sorting.
- I’m really proud of this one. Split the posters, presentations, etc.
by year in the overview pages.
- Enforce constant widths in tables so that separate tables line up.
- Fix minor typo in Ranjita’s news update.
- Stop listing news post author on homepage.
tsalo added 9 commits October 14, 2017 17:41
I also enforced heights on the rows of the tables on the presentations,
posters, and papers pages. This fixes some of the spacing problems.

Also, I updated the README file and the pages of our alumni.
The anchors to “Join Us” and “Contact” didn’t account for the
navigation bar. By creating a new class in the CSS style sheet with a
hardcoded offset of 45 pixels, we can deal with this.
- I’ve done a pretty solid job of dealing with the photo aspect ratios.
- Added borders around most images. Especially helpful for
papers/presentations with white backgrounds.
- Check out those social icons on the Team page!!!!
- Added some more papers and projects.
- Made Projects page a table like the other pages.
Hopefully this will improve discoverability for the site.
@benshe3 benshe3 merged commit 0db5340 into NBCLab:staging Oct 17, 2017
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ants